Cost of Surge Protection for Your Entire Home in Santa Fe, NM

The average cost for whole house surge protector in Santa Fe, New Mexico ranges from $300-$600. Pricing varies based on project scope, materials selected, labor rates in the Santa Fe area, and site-specific conditions. Budget-level projects use standard materials suitable for basic upgrades, mid-range projects incorporate higher-quality materials preferred by most Santa Fe homeowners, and premium projects feature top-tier materials with custom design elements ideal for luxury properties.

Labor costs in Santa Fe are influenced by local market conditions and contractor availability. Permits and Regulations in Santa Fe, NM

Most electrical projects in Santa Fe require permits from the local building department. Requirements vary by project scope, but any work involving structural changes, electrical systems, plumbing, or mechanical systems typically requires permitting. Your contractor should handle the entire permit process as part of their services. Unpermitted work can result in fines, complications during property sales, and potential safety hazards.
